Quit alcohol: what your body does when you stop
For daily heavy drinkers, acute alcohol withdrawal runs roughly 6–72 hours and can be medically dangerous — seek guidance before stopping. Sleep and mood typically rebound from week 2, liver fat starts dropping within two weeks, and mild fatty liver can largely reverse in 4–6 weeks.
Alcohol touches nearly every organ, which means recovery does too: within days your sleep architecture starts to rebuild, within weeks your liver begins clearing accumulated fat, and within months measurable repair shows up in your heart, skin and brain.
This timeline is compiled from clinical literature and public health sources. Every milestone is tagged with an evidence level — 'solid' means repeatedly confirmed in humans; 'indicative' means early or observational research.
Withdrawal at a glance
| Symptom | Starts | Peaks | Eases |
|---|---|---|---|
| Tremor & sweating | 6–12 h | 24–72 h | Week 1 |
| Anxiety & restlessness | Day 1 | Week 1 | Weeks 2–4 |
| Insomnia / poor sleep | Night 1 | Week 1 | Weeks 2–4 |
| Cravings | Day 2 | Weeks 1–2 | Thin over months |
| Mood dips (PAWS) | Weeks 2–4 | Variable | Months, in waves |

Your body's recovery timeline
Gloom
Acute withdrawal · Days 0–3
Cellular Shock and Autonomic Storm Hours 0–24
The nervous system, freed from alcohol's suppression, enters a shock of over-excitation.
- Hour 2Blood Alcohol Level Falling
The liver works overtime to burn alcohol; the glycogen stores that stabilize blood sugar begin to deplete.
Solid evidence - Hour 4Reactive Hypoglycemia
Because alcohol temporarily blocks the liver's sugar production, blood sugar falls; drowsiness and muscle tremors follow.
Solid evidence - Hour 6First Tremors and Sympathetic Activation
The glutamate receptors alcohol suppressed fire uncontrollably and GABA falls short; the pulse rises, and sweating and hand tremors begin.
Solid evidence - Hour 8Autonomic Tension and Anxiety
Plasma adrenaline/noradrenaline peaks; the heart rhythm speeds up (tachycardia).
Solid evidence - Hour 10Excess Gastric Acid Secretion
When alcohol's stomach stimulation lifts, reactive acid secretion (gastrin) rises; heartburn and nausea are triggered.
Solid evidence - Hour 12Sensory Disturbance (Hallucinosis)
The glutamate storm affects the sensory cortex; unreal sounds, shadows, or itching sensations may occur.
Solid evidence - Hour 16Neurological Over-Firing
NMDA glutamate receptors reach their peak; oversensitivity to light and sound (hyperacusis) is at its height.
Solid evidence - Hour 20Peak Liver Oxidative Stress
The buildup of acetaldehyde, the carcinogenic intermediate of alcohol breakdown, is at its peak; free radicals push the headache to its maximum.
Solid evidence - Hour 24Peak Neurological Seizure Risk
Excess glutamate and a lack of GABA can lead to an uncontrolled electrical discharge (a seizure); blood pressure peaks.
Solid evidence
Liver Crisis and DT Threat Hours 24–72
An electrolyte and liver crisis; the most critical threshold is crossed.
- Hour 30Holiday Heart Arrhythmia
Loss of potassium/magnesium and high adrenaline can cause atrial fibrillation; palpitations are intense.
Solid evidence - Hour 36Dehydration and Electrolyte Crisis
With alcohol's diuretic effect, water and electrolytes (potassium, magnesium) fall critically; cramps begin.
Solid evidence - Hour 42Acute Liver Cell Leakage
The AST/ALT enzymes leaking from damaged hepatocytes reach their highest level in the blood.
Solid evidence - Hour 48Delirium Tremens (DT) Threshold
In severe dependence, the autonomic system can lose control; intense confusion, fever, hallucinations, and a blood-pressure spike may appear.
Solid evidence - Hour 54Excessive Sweating
Beta-adrenergic receptors are hypersensitive; the hypothalamic thermostat is disrupted, and night sweats appear.
Solid evidence - Hour 60REM Rebound
When alcohol's REM suppression lifts, the brain enters an excess-REM mode; vivid dreams and jolts as you fall asleep occur.
Solid evidence - Hour 66Onset of Natural Vasopressin (ADH)
ADH begins returning to normal; the kidneys reabsorb water, and urination frequency decreases.
Solid evidence - Hour 72The Acute Physical Crisis Breaks
Glutamate hypersensitivity begins to decrease (downregulation); the autonomic system balances, and seizure risk drops sharply.
Solid evidence
Cleansing
Cellular cleanup · Days 3–21
Cellular Cleanup and Tissue Repair Days 3–21
Gut, liver, and brain tissues are repaired at the cellular level.
- Day 4Falling Neurotoxicity
Excess glutamate is cleared; neuron death from a calcium influx (excitotoxicity) stops.
Reasonable evidence - Day 5Vitamin B1 (Thiamine) Absorption
Alcohol's blocking of the thiamine channels in the gut lifts; Wernicke-Korsakoff risk recedes.
Solid evidence - Day 6Pancreas and Stomach Repair
Chronic gastritis and pancreatic enzyme blockage resolve; amylase/lipase and stomach acid balance.
Reasonable evidence - Day 7Vasopressin (ADH) Balance
ADH reaches balance; the kidney's water filtration and retention balance returns to normal.
Solid evidence - Day 8Cellular Rehydration
ADH release returns to normal; intracellular water balance is established, and edema and swelling subside.
Solid evidence - Day 9Liver Enzyme Synthesis
The liver restores protein/albumin synthesis to normal; the speed of processing drugs and nutrients improves.
Reasonable evidence - Day 10Blood Pressure Normalization
As the autonomic system calms, vascular resistance decreases; the chronic adrenaline-driven constriction relaxes.
Solid evidence - Day 11Fatty Liver Receding
Once alcohol burning stops, fatty acid oxidation restarts; accumulated triglycerides are burned.
Solid evidence - Day 12Stomach Lining Renewal
The eroded stomach epithelium completes its 3–4 day cell-division cycle; gastritis pains subside.
Solid evidence - Day 13Deep Sleep (Delta Waves)
Slow-wave sleep (Delta) reactivates; the physical-repair and growth-hormone stage falls into order.
Reasonable evidence - Day 14Brain Tissue Rehydration
The brain tissue shrunk by chronic dehydration retains water; the gray matter physically expands.
Reasonable evidence - Day 15Falling Gut Permeability
The disrupted gut tight junctions are repaired; endotoxin leaking into the blood decreases.
Reasonable evidence - Day 16Chronic Inflammation Receding
Inflammatory cytokines (IL-6, TNF-alpha) decrease; white blood cell levels return to normal.
Reasonable evidence - Day 17Capillary Tone
The chronic capillary widening (vasodilation) in the face and eyes ends; the vessels return to their normal diameter.
Reasonable evidence - Day 18Skin Barrier Repair
The chronic widening of the skin's vessels stops; the skin barrier begins to hold moisture.
Reasonable evidence - Day 20Motor Coordination
The temporary neurotoxicity in the cerebellum is cleared; hand-eye coordination and balance quicken.
Solid evidence - Day 21Synapse Regeneration
Synaptic connections are remapped to an alcohol-free order; muscle twitches and fine tremors end.
Solid evidence
